A man was robbed inside a hotel at 16th and Mission streets at 6 p.m. Wednesday. The man told police that he was inside the hotel when four suspects, described as a man in his mid-20s and three women who appeared to be in their 30s, entered and threatened the victim with an unseen handgun.
The suspects took an MP3 player and some cash from the victim and fled the area.
